Brief description

The Wallaby-Zenith Fracture Zone Survey was acquired by the Minderoo-UWA Deep-Sea Research Centre at the University of Western Australia during the expedition “Indomitable” onboard the RV DSSV Pressure Drop from the 8th March to the 2nd June 2021 led by Dr. Alan Jamieson, using a Kongsberg EM124. The expedition was funded by a joint mission between Caladan Oceanic LLC (US) and the Minderoo Foundation (Australia). This dataset contains a 64m-resolution and a 128mm-resolution 32-bit floating point GeoTIFF files of the bathymetry in the study area, derived from the processed EM124 bathymetry data, using QPS Qimera v.2.5 software. Survey metadata:
The multibeam bathymetry was acquired by the following survey:
- Survey Name: Wallaby-Zenith Fracture Zone
- Vessel Name: RV DSSV Pressure Drop
- Institution: The University of Western Australia
- Country: Australia
- Operator: Caladan Oceanic, LLC
- Multibeam system: EM124
- Year of installation: 2019
- Nominal sonar frequency: 12 kHz
- Number of heads: 1
- Number of soundings: 1600
- Beamwidth along track: 0.5 degree
- Beamwidth across track: 1 degree
- Pulse length: variable
- Selectable depth range: variable
- Vessel speed: Unknown
- Start Date: 08/03/2021
- End Date: 02/06/2021
- Start Port: Dampier
- End Port: Fremantle
- Grid resolution: 64m, 128m
- Number of grids: 2

Processing methodology:
The bathymetric dataset was processed using QPS Qimera v2.5 as follow:
1. QPD generation
2. Raytracing with earest in distance withing time
3. Tide correction
4. TPU application
5. Data cleaning
6. QC
7. Surface Processing
8. Cube surface generation
9. Surface finalisation
10. Export surface as a 32-bit floating Geotiff, referenced to EGM2008, WGS 84 (EPSG:4326).
11. GSF Export

DATA QUALITY

This dataset has been subject to independent post-production validation and testing. Tests have been performed for data completeness, correct spatial representation, attribute accuracy, logical consistency, metadata completeness and correctness, and where appropriate for compliance with Geoscience Australia's data dictionaries.
